<p class="Inside-first-paragraph-drop-cap">Like other healthcare workers, infection preventionists have been overwhelmed in the churning waves of the <span style="color: rgb(65, 65, 65); letter-spacing: normal; orphans: 2; text-align: left; white-space: normal; widows: 2; word-spacing: 0px; display: inline !important; float: none;">SARS-CoV-2</span> pandemic. An unpublished survey conducted by the Association for Professionals in Infection Control and Epidemiology and The Ohio State University School of Nursing revealed a “startling” level of stress and burnout.</p>
